Former Mizzou commit is re-committing in June
Defensive end recruit Shemar Pearl has been enamored with Mizzou for a long time. He committed to Barry Odom’s team during the 2019 recruiting cycle, but was unable to make the roster out of high school for academic reasons. He’s since gone to Garden City Community College and become a coveted JUCO prospect and has seen his recruitment narrow to three schools — Missouri, Texas Tech and SEC rival South Carolina. On Sunday, Pearl announced he’d be announcing his new commitment in June.

Shemar has been pretty pro-Mizzou online, and seems to be keen on getting to Columbia at some point. His original high school offer sheet was incredibly impressive, and his big frame (6’5”, 235 pounds) would be a welcome addition to the 2021 roster. There seems to be reason to like Missouri here, but South Carolina has made a big push. We’ll find out in a month if Eli Drinkwitz is able to close the deal with Pearl.
